Find the circumference and area of a circle with a diameter of 14 inches. Leave your answers in terms of pi.
IRINA_888 [86]

Step-by-step explanation:

step 1. The circumference (c) of a circle is the diameter of a circle x pi. c = d(pi) = 14pi.

step 2. The area (A) of a circle is the radius of a circle squared x pi. The radius of a circle is 1/2 x the diameter. A = (14/2)^2(pi) = 49pi.
